# coding=utf-8 import connexion import copy import requests import json import time import uuid from celery import Celery from celery ...
celery A proj worker loglevel info 這個錯誤原因在於proj這里沒有包含對應的task, 可以在這里導入需要的task即可 ...
2020-09-18 21:46 0 606 推薦指數:
# coding=utf-8 import connexion import copy import requests import json import time import uuid from celery import Celery from celery ...
目錄 原因 解決過程 原因 因為最近項目需求中需要提供對異步執行任務終止的功能,所以在尋找停止celery task任務的方法。這種需求以前沒有碰到過,所以,只能求助於百度和google,但是找遍了資料,都沒找到相關的能停止celery task任務的方法 ...
任務是構建 celery 應用的基礎塊。 任務是可以在任何除可調用對象外的地方創建的一個類。它扮演着雙重角色,它定義了一個任務被調用時會發生什么(發送一個消息),以及一個工作單元獲取到消息之后將會做什么。 每個任務都有不同的名稱,發給 celery 的任務消息中會引用這個名稱,工作單 ...
一.Celery 介紹 Celery 是一個強大的分布式任務隊列,它可以讓任務的執行完全脫離主程序,甚至可以被分配到其他主機上運行。我們通常使用它來實現異步任務( async task )和定時任務( crontab )。 異步任務比如是發送郵件、或者文件上傳, 圖像處理等等一些比較耗時的操作 ...
序列文章: Celery 源碼解析一:Worker 啟動流程概述 Celery 源碼解析二:Worker 的執行引擎 Celery 源碼解析三: Task 對象的實現 Celery 源碼解析四: 定時任務的實現 Celery 源碼解析五: 遠程控制管理 ...
celery beat 是一個調度器;它以常規的時間間隔開啟任務,任務將會在集群中的可用節點上運行。 默認情況下,入口項是從 beat_schedule 設置中獲取,但是自定義的存儲也可以使用,例如在 SQL 數據庫中存儲入口項。 你必須保證一個調度一次只被一個調度器運行,否則將會形成重復 ...
當我們在使用airflow調度系統的時候,出現以下問題 網上有帖子說是通過加入線程來解決問題,然后,Airflow會等到所有線程執行完畢后再發送SIG ...